3. Joint entropy priors

4. Gaussian-mixture priors

•Tikhonov 0 == single Gaussian

•Use mixture of k Gaussians

•Iteratively:

•K-means cluster class statistics

•Construct inv. covariance Cx-1, mean μx

•Reconstruct with prior Cx-1, μx
